How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Dunn Loring?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Dunn Loring Luxury Studio Apartments | $2,168 | $1,470 | $3,345 |
| Dunn Loring Luxury 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,457 | $1,454 | $10,000+ |
| Dunn Loring Luxury 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,170 | $1,741 | $10,000+ |
| Dunn Loring Luxury 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,351 | $2,008 | $6,417 |
| Dunn Loring Luxury 4 Bedroom Apartments | $8,783 | $7,804 | $9,763 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Dunn Loring
How much are Studio apartments in Dunn Loring?
There are currently 51 Studio Apartments in Dunn Loring with rent ranges from $1,470 to $3,345 with an average price of $2,168.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Dunn Loring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Dunn Loring ranges from $1,454 to $10,061 with an average monthly rent of $2,457.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Dunn Loring c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Dunn Loring range from $1,741 to $14,210.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,170.
How expensive are Dunn Loring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 49 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Dunn Loring on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,008 to $6,417 - averaging $3,351 for the location.
